Nettet8. okt. 2012 · I have found 3-6 reps to be ideal with this method, combined with 3-5 total sets. Take about 85% of 1RM, perform one rep, rest 10-20 seconds, repeat for 3-6 reps. Rest 2-3 minutes and do that about 5 times. Just like the previous cluster set, add a small amount of weight when you repeat this workout.
